Brown sent the plater Eil-Weir to Bash-ford Manor Stud to be turned out for the year. J. N. Crofton is shipping ten horses hero from Suffolk Downs. Clyde Van Dusen, trainer of Charles T. Fishers Dixiana, and Mrs. Van Dusen, arrived from Latonia. Van Dusen supervised preparation of Manager Mike and Matas Brother, Thursday morning. Four horses the property of M. MacMaster six Monte Preston is training for various awners arrived from Kansas City. Jockey O. Webster accepted his first mount the meeting on Imperial Lu in the first Thursday. Charles Stevenson, leading rider of America in 1935, who came in from Latonia, lost time getting into action and was astride horses this afternoon. Louis Abel, former owner of Idle Flirt, is visiting his brother, A. J. Abel. R. Rushton arrived from Toronto with 3aydrop, Hasty Belle and Bushman. For carrying Inheritor, which was placed Fourth in the fourth race, out in the stretchj Erwin was set down for ten days.
